Hi all,

MIL came on at the weekend, followed by Adblue fault warning on the dash.

Took to an Audi specialist yesterday & the underside of the car is covered in crystallised Adblue. The pipe is split & so is the top of the injector. £1,100 to replace those parts. Or to be thorough, £2,000ish to replace the whole system.

Plus,

Error code was thrown up p191a loss of crankshaft synchronisation. Sounds like the timing chain & tensioner are stretched but is there any value in trying more minor stuff first, like a sensor or changing the battery? Or could it be related to the adblue failure?

2016 A6 C6.7, 3.0 BiTDI (320) Avant. Serviced since I bought it in 2918 at 31k miles by Audi & I changed the intervals from long life to 10K/annual while I’ve had it too, to try to look after her. Fat lot of good it’s done me lol. All advice from people who know these faults very much appreciated.
